McDonald's Unveils Bacon and Cheese Loaded Fries, and Life Is Now Complete

With curly fries in Singapore and sweet potato fries in Australia, it was time for McDonald's to show some love to us fast-food-lovers in the United States, and the new menu item does not disappoint. McDonald's has been testing out Loaded Bacon & Cheese Basket of Fries in select stores over the country, filling our hearts and our arteries with pure joy.

The new dish is made with McDonald's beloved fries, topped with cheddar cheese sauce, and the applewood-smoked bacon that's used on its burgers and breakfast sandwiches. The fries are being sold for $4, and while the advertisement claims the basket serves two, they obviously don't know us.

Brand Eating reports the new drool-worthy menu item will only be available at stores in the greater Pittsburgh area, Central West Virginia, Southeast Ohio, and Eastern Kentucky, but hey, that's a start.
